The size of the stripped binaries should be compared. ELF binaries contain both link-time sections and loadable segments, and the longer name of C++ symbols only affects disk space (for both the link-time symbol table and for debug information). The size of the runtime-loadable segments is really the only thing of interest, and stripping the binaries gives you a truer indication of this.
